Kate Middleton looked elegant in an all-white outfit as she attended the Order of the Garter service on Monday, an important outing on the royal calendar.
She may be the Princess Of Wales but Kate proved she was a sustainable queen as she re-wore one of her favourite outfits for the third time - a midi dress by Self Portrait.
The mother-of-three, 43, showed no fear of outfit repeating as she continued her run of re-wears in the chiffon pleated skirt and tailored boucle blazer for another outing, after wearing it last month to the celebratory concert to mark the 80th anniversary of VE Day.

She first wore the dress from the London-based the luxury brand four years ago to a reception at The National Portrait Gallery and it has clearly remained a favourite in her wardrobe ever since.

Kate went for timeless elegance for her jewellery, wearing a pair of vintage pearl earrings and a matching five-strand pearl necklace by designer Susan Caplan that she previously wore with her VE Day concert look.
However, she switched up her accessories with a signature saucer-style hat by milliner Sean Barrett, matching the exact shade of her dress.

The service took place at St George's Chapel in Windsor Castle followed by a parade and the Princess was seen laughing with fellow royals at the event including Prince Edward's wife Sophie, the Duchess of Edinburgh, and Princess Alexandra of Kent.
Her appearance this year marks a welcome return to usual proceedings after Kate was unable to attend last year's Garter Day as she was undergoing chemotherapy after her cancer diagnosis.

This comes after she attended the Trooping Of The Colour event on Saturday for her father-in-law King Charles' birthday with her children Prince George, Princess Charlotte, and Prince Louis, as Prince William rode on horseback.

Kate was twinning with her daughter Charlotte in blue ensembles with mum Kate in a brightly-coloured Bria coat dress from Catherine Walker and the young princess in a muted teal dress.
